Screen Institute Beirut Movies, TV Series

Released
A World Not Ours
2014 93 min
Movie
A World Not Ours
Released
Xenos
2013 12 min
Movie
Xenos
Released
Whose Country?
2016 58 min
Movie
Whose Country?
×